Fertilizing Shrubs in Fall
When should I fertilize shrubs?
Mid to late fall (after leaf drop but before the ground freezes) is the ideal period for fertilization. During this time, shrubs naturally shift energy away from top growth and direct nutrients into root development.
How do I fertilize shrubs in the fall?

Light Pruning & Fall Cleanup
Can bushes be trimmed in the fall?
Yes, with caution. Trimming should focus on removing dead, damaged, or diseased wood — not major reshaping. Pruning shrubs in the fall helps prevent the spread of disease and improves airflow, especially for dense or overgrown areas.
Trimming bushes in the fall also plays a critical role in wildfire mitigation. Clearing out dry, woody material and performing dead shrub removal can significantly reduce fire hazards, particularly in foothills and wildland-urban interface zones.
Can you trim evergreen bushes in the fall?
Light shaping is okay, but avoid hard cuts to prevent winter damage.
